According to the NIRF report for 2022 and available data, the placement at NIT Agartala for B.Tech. Is as follows: 1. The average salary package offered to B.Tech graduates is around INR 7 LPA. 2. Around 525 students out of a total of 645 students get campus placement in various companies in the 2021 batch. 3. The graduates have been placed in companies like ALSTOM, Larsen & Toubro, and Capgemini. 4. Some of the students preferred higher studies like MS and PhDs from foreign institutions. 5. The branches like ECE and CSE have been close to 100% in recent years at NIT Agartala.

JEE Main 2023
NTA has announced the JEE Main 2023 exam dates at JEE Main. NTA. Nic. In. The session 1 of JEE Main 2023 will be conducted on January 24, 25, 28, 29, 30, 31, and February 1, while the IIT JEE Main second phase is scheduled to held on April 06, 08, 10, 11 and 12.

FTII (Film and Television Institute of India) is an autonomous institute under the Ministry of Information and Broadcasting of the GoI and aided by the Central GoI. It is situated on the premises of the erstwhile Prabhat Film Company in Pune. The film and Television Institute of India is a member of the CILECT (International Liaison Centre of Schools of Cinema and Television), an organisation of the world's leading schools of film and television.
